Best Practices for RTO Compliance:

To minimise risks, consider
these methods:

- Establish a Plan for Regulatory Compliance: Lay out your RTO's compliance plans, and strategies, and roles. This plan should include a schedule for internal reviews, staff education on compliance procedures, and a procedure for addressing non-compliance issues.
- Develop a Compliance Ethos: Support candid communication about compliance matters across all levels. Be sure employees are aware their tasks in maintaining compliance. Praise compliance achievements and learn from any flaws.
- Embrace Technology: Use tech systems to boost compliance operations. Use an online learning system to track student development and learning outcomes. Leverage an electronic records management system to safely keep and maintain compliance paperwork.

- Associate with Industry Stakeholders: Engage in sector networks and communities to stay updated on effective practices and modern trends. Engage with industry organisations and entities to support your educational programs are up-to-date and match business demands.

ASQA performs routine audits on RTOs to inspect their compliance with the standards.

These audits happen announced or unannounced and typically involve document inspections, interviews with staff and learners, and monitoring of training and assessment activities.

Getting ready for an RTO compliance checklist ASQA audit demands detailed planning and focused attention. Check that your documentation is up-to-date, your staff are well-prepared, and your processes are arranged. Consider running a mock audit to locate and rectify any areas of potential non-compliance.
